**Q: How do I get into the first-aid room?**

Good question — it comes up a lot in your first week. The first-aid room at Pellow Wharf is on the ground floor, just past the kitchenette, and it stays locked so supplies don't wander off. Any trained first aider can let you in, and there's a list of them pinned to the noticeboard. If it's urgent and no first aider is around, reception can open it remotely, or you can use the keypad yourself — the door code is below.

turnstile pass: bdg-FVNQRS-72965873

Q: Why did queries get slow after the Tarnwell 4.2 upgrade?
A: The planner started favoring nested-loop joins on the events table once stats drifted past a size threshold. Classic regression — the cost model underestimates our skewed tenant distribution. Workaround: run the stats refresh job nightly and pin the join hint in heavy reports. We filed it upstream; fix lands in 4.3. Unsealing the planner-config vault takes the recovery passphrase below.

recovery phrase for fahif-hadup: sorix-holael

**Action item (password reset revamp postmortem):** Welcome aboard — quick context. Last quarter's reset-flow revamp on Fernbright shipped with a token-expiry mismatch, so some users got "link expired" instantly. We fixed the clock skew handling and added a staging check, but the real takeaway is: any auth-flow change now needs a dry run against the Harlow test tenant first. Details, the checklist, and the full incident write-up are all collected on the team's internal page.

wiki page, tahaf-tajog: https://jira.ordindyn.corp/pipeline